Introduction Mistakenly called "tidal wave" the word tsunami is a Japanese word meaning‚ "harbor wave". A tsunami is a series of traveling ocean waves of extremely long length generated by disturbances associated primarily with earthquakes occurring below or near the ocean floor. Tsunamis are primarily the result of a vertical displacement of water and rank high on the scale of natural disasters. Katsushika Hokusai. The Great Wave off Kanagawa from Thirty-Six Views of Mount Fuji. c. 1831. Polychrome woodblock print on paper‚ 9 7/8” x 14 5/8” (25 x 37.1 cm). Hokusai’s The Great Wave off Kanagawa is a woodblock print that was published around 1831‚ and it is one of the most iconic Japanese works of art in the world. It depicts a colossal wave about to come crashing down on three fishing boats‚ or oshiokuri-bune—Japanese fishing boats that are known for their speed (Cartwright and Nakamura)
